Hello All, I have just picked up a model 90 with two barrel sets. Both are with matching ser #.
does anyone have any idea how many of these set were made and if they are worth a bit of a premium. There is nothing that I could find in the marlin bible.

Bruce;
There were some two barrel sets made, and most likely on special order. I know of one three (3) barrel set that was made up for one of Marlin's dealers that wanted a special set when he visited the factory. How many were made? Who knows other than the factory, and the records of the Model 90 have never been thoroughly researched as far as I know.
Yes, the extra barrel with matching serial number would add to the value.
